Frequently Asked Questions about vacation rentals in Denmark

  • What are the must-see places in Denmark?

    For must-see places, you absolutely have to visit Copenhagen's Tivoli Gardens, a historic amusement park, and Rosenborg Castle, housing the Danish crown jewels. Outside Copenhagen, explore Kronborg Castle in Helsingør, the setting for Shakespeare's Hamlet, and the charming canals and colorful houses of Nyhavn. Don't forget the Little Mermaid statue, a quintessential Copenhagen landmark.

  • What are the typical activities to do in Denmark?

    Denmark offers diverse activities. Cycling is hugely popular; rent a bike and explore the countryside or city streets. Stroll through charming towns like Aarhus or Odense. Visit museums like the National Museum of Denmark in Copenhagen or the ARoS Aarhus Art Museum. Enjoy the numerous parks and green spaces, perfect for picnics and relaxation. Consider a canal tour in Copenhagen for a unique perspective of the city.

  • Which part of Denmark offers the most pleasant climate?

    Southern Denmark generally experiences the warmest temperatures and the most sunshine. Areas around Odense and the islands of Funen and Ærø tend to have milder weather than the northern parts of the country, particularly during the summer months.

  • What airport options are there for reaching Denmark?

    Copenhagen Airport (CPH) is the main international airport, serving most major airlines. Billund Airport (BLL) in Jutland is another significant airport, particularly useful for travelers heading to western Denmark. Smaller regional airports exist, but CPH and BLL handle the vast majority of international flights.

  • Are there specific challenges to driving in Denmark that visitors should know?

    Driving in Denmark is generally straightforward, but be aware of toll roads, particularly on major highways like the E20. Also, remember to drive on the right side of the road. Parking can be expensive and limited in city centers, so consider public transportation or cycling where possible. Speed limits are strictly enforced.

  • What currency is used in Denmark?

    The Danish krone (DKK) is the official currency.
  • What are the top festivals to experience in Denmark?

    Roskilde Festival is a massive music festival held annually, attracting international acts. Copenhagen Jazz Festival is another significant event showcasing jazz musicians from around the world. Numerous smaller local festivals celebrate various aspects of Danish culture throughout the year.
  • What is the best time of year to visit Denmark?

    The best time to visit depends on your priorities. Summer (June-August) offers warm weather and long daylight hours, ideal for outdoor activities. Spring and autumn provide pleasant temperatures and fewer crowds. Winter can be cold, but offers a unique charm with Christmas markets and cozy cafes.
  • What are some local dishes to try in Denmark?

    Definitely try smørrebrød, open-faced sandwiches with various toppings. Frikadeller, Danish meatballs, are another classic. Try also the traditional pastries like wienerbrød (viennoiserie) and the delicious Danish cheeses. For a sweet treat, indulge in aebleskiver, small spherical pancakes.
  • What emergency numbers should you know in case of a medical or security issue in Denmark?

    For medical emergencies, dial 112. For police or other security issues, also dial 112.
  • What etiquette tips are important when visiting Denmark?

    Danes generally value punctuality and direct communication. It's considered polite to say 'please' and 'thank you'. Tipping is not mandatory but appreciated for good service. Being mindful of personal space is also important.
  • What are the best areas to spend a week in Denmark?

    A week allows for exploring multiple regions. Consider a base in Copenhagen for a few days, exploring the city's attractions, then venturing to other areas like Jutland, exploring its coastline and charming towns like Aarhus, or the islands of Funen and Zealand for a slower pace.
  • What are the best areas to spend a weekend in Denmark?

    For a weekend, focusing on one area is best. Copenhagen offers plenty to see and do within a couple of days. Alternatively, explore a specific region like the picturesque coastline of North Jutland or the historic city of Odense.
  • What are the top shopping destinations in Denmark?

    Strøget in Copenhagen is a famous pedestrian shopping street with a wide variety of shops. Illums Bolighus is a high-end department store in Copenhagen. Magasin du Nord is another large department store in Copenhagen. Many smaller boutiques and specialty shops are found throughout the country, particularly in larger cities.
  • What are some off-the-beaten-path places to explore in Denmark?

    Explore the Wadden Sea National Park for unique natural beauty and wildlife. Visit the island of Bornholm for its dramatic cliffs and charming towns. Explore smaller towns and villages in Jutland, away from the main tourist routes, to experience a more authentic Danish countryside experience.
